If you plan to study Music Performance, you may want to check out the program at Bethel University. The following information will help you decide if it is a good fit for you.

Bethel University is in Saint Paul, MN.

In the most recent year for which we have data, 4 music performance degrees were granted at Bethel University.

Online & Distance Learning at Bethel University

Online coursework is an option at Bethel University. Of 3,603 students, 741 (21%) studied exclusively online and 1,137 (32%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Below you’ll find the student demographics for Music Performance graduates at Bethel University, broken down by degree level.

Looking at the program as a whole, Music Performance graduates at Bethel University are 50% women (2) and 50% men (2).

Music Performance Bachelor’s Program at Bethel University

Of the 4 bachelor’s music performance degrees awarded at Bethel University, 50% were women (2) and 50% were men (2).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Music Performance bachelor’s degree recipients at Bethel University.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 2
Hispanic / Latino 2
Racial-ethnic diversity of Music Performance majors at Bethel University

Minority students account for 50% of Music Performance bachelor’s degree recipients at Bethel University, higher than the national average of 33%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
